Background: To evaluate the efficacy and adverse events of cisplatin, tegafur, and leucovorin concomitantly with radiotherapy for patients with advanced, non-metastatic squamous cell carcinoma (SCC) of the oropharynx and hypopharynx.

Methods: The PTL regimen consisted of cisplatin (P) 50 mg/m 2 on day 1, oral tegafur (T) 800 mg/day plus leucovorin (LV) 60 mg/day on days 1 through 14. It was repeated every 2 weeks through the radiotherapy course.

Background: The association between human leukocyte antigen (HLA) genes (located in the Major Histocompatibility Complex [MHC] region of chromosome 6p21) and NPC has been known for some time. Recently, two genome-wide association studies (GWAS) conducted in Taiwan and China confirmed that the strongest evidence for NPC association was mapped to the MHC region. It is still unclear, however, whether these findings reflect direct associations with Human Leukocyte Antigen (HLA) genes and/or to other genes in this gene-rich region.

Aim: To understand the frequency, clinical significance, and benefits of salvage therapy in oral cavity squamous cell carcinoma (OSCC) patients with regional nodal recurrence at unusual sites (prelaryngeal area, parotid area, and retropharyngeal area).

Methods: We examined 178 patients with neck recurrence at levels I-V (usual group) and 26 patients outside levels I-V (unusual group). The 5-year survival rates served as the main outcome measure.
